About This Novel

This book is compiled from the postgraduate course "History of Modern and Contemporary Chinese Literature". Faced with the characteristics of short class hours and large capacity, we try to construct a literary history theory based on the "big historical view" of French new history master Fernand Braudel and the literary history narrative method of the British and American New Criticism's genre model and day and night alternating model. The basic viewpoints and methods adhered to in this book are: taking the century-old literary history as the perspective, using representative writers as the observation point, using different genres as the observation perspective, and trying to highlight the works of writers who have made outstanding contributions to the history of literature as much as possible. Even for the writers mentioned, they do not give a comprehensive discussion, but focus on certain specific types or specific works. That is to say, we should pursue the macroscopic view on the macroscopic level and the microscopic view on the microscopic view, so as to realize the "detumescence" of historical theory under the tension of "face" and "point". In the evaluation of specific writers, we will not stick to current stereotypes. In some aspects, we will adopt personal understanding and expression to convey a personal view of history.
